虚拟机安装Linux系统教程
虚拟机怎么装linux

作者:IIS7AI 时间:2025-01-05 15:55



虚拟机安装Linux系统全面指南 在当今的计算机世界中,虚拟机已经成为开发和测试不可或缺的工具

    通过虚拟机,你可以在同一台物理机上运行多个操作系统,而不会互相干扰

    本文将详细介绍如何在虚拟机中安装Linux系统,特别是CentOS 7,确保步骤详尽,让你一次搞定

     一、准备工作 首先,你需要准备以下工具和文件: 1.虚拟机软件:推荐使用VMware Workstation Pro或VMware Fusion(macOS用户)

    这些软件功能强大且用户友好,非常适合初学者和高级用户

     2.Linux ISO镜像文件:下载CentOS 7的ISO镜像文件

    你可以从搜狐镜像站或其他可信的Linux发行版镜像站点下载

     下载链接: - CentOS 7 ISO镜像文件:【Index of /centos/7/isos/x86_64/】(http://mirror.sohu.com/centos/7/isos/x86_64/) - VMware Workstation Pro:前往【VMware官网】(https://www.vmware.com/products/workstation-pro.html)下载最新版本

     二、安装虚拟机软件 下载完成后,按照以下步骤安装VMware Workstation Pro: 1.运行安装程序:双击下载的VMware安装程序,并按照屏幕上的指示进行安装

     2.接受许可协议:阅读并接受VMware的许可协议

     3.选择安装位置:选择VMware的安装路径,通常建议使用默认路径

     4.完成安装:等待安装程序完成,并重启计算机(如果提示)

     三、新建虚拟机 1.打开VMware Workstation Pro:启动VMware Workstation Pro

     2.创建新的虚拟机: - 在主界面上,点击“创建新的虚拟机”

     - 选择“自定义(高级)(C)”,然后点击“下一步”

     - 点击“下一步”跳过兼容性检查

     - 选择“稍后安装操作系统(S)”,点击“下一步”

     - 在客户机操作系统选项中,选择“Linux”,版本选择“Red Hat Enterprise Linux 7 64位”,点击“下一步”

     - 为虚拟机命名,并选择存储位置

    建议将虚拟机文件存放在非C盘,然后点击“下一步”

     3.配置处理器和内存: - 根据你的计算机配置,设置处理器数量和每个处理器的内核数量

    一般来说,分配给虚拟机的内核数量应小于或等于物理机内核数量的一半

     - 为虚拟机分配内存(RAM)

    对于学习用途,建议分配至少2GB内存

     4.配置网络: - 选择“使用网络地址转换(NAT)(E)”,这是默认选项,通常不需要修改

     5.选择I/O控制器: - 选择默认的“LSI Logic(L)(推荐)”,点击“下一步”

     6.选择磁盘控制器: - 选择默认的“SCSI(S)(推荐)”,点击“下一步”

     7.创建虚拟磁盘: - 选择“创建新虚拟磁盘”

     - 设置最大磁盘大小

    对于大多数用途,20GB至50GB的磁盘空间足够

    注意,这里的磁盘大小以后不能更改,建议直接按默认的20GB

     - 取消勾选“立即分配所有磁盘空间”,这可以节省磁盘空间并提升性能

     8.完成虚拟机配置: - 点击“下一步”,然后点击“完成”以完成虚拟机配置

     四、配置虚拟机硬件 1.编辑虚拟机设置: - 在左侧虚拟机列表中,选择你创建的虚拟机

     - 在右侧点击“编辑虚拟机设置”

     2.配置CD/DVD驱动器: - 在硬件列表中,点击“CD/DVD(IDE)”

     - 选择“使用ISO映像文件(M)”,然后点击“浏览”,选择你之前下载的CentOS 7 ISO镜像文件

     3.调整其他硬件设置(可选): - 根据需要,你可以调整其他硬件设置,如USB控制器、打印机等

     五、安装Linux系统 1.启动虚拟机: - 在虚拟机列表中,选择你创建的虚拟机,然后点击“开启此虚拟机”

     2.开始安装: - 虚拟机启动后,选择第一个选项“Install CentOS 7”

     - 等待初始化完成,然后选择语言(中文)

     3.配置安装选项: - 在安装信息摘要界面中,等待“安装源”和“软件选择”的黄色感叹号消失

     - 点击“软件选择”,选择“GNOME桌面环境”和“开发工具”

    GNOME桌面环境提供了图形用户界面,适合初学者

    开发工具则包含了一些常用的编程工具和库

     4.配置分区: - 点击“安装位置”,选择“我要配置分区”

     - 进入手动分区界面,按照以下步骤进行分区: - 点击左下角的“+”标志,挂载点选择“/”(根目录),分配17GB(注意加G)

     - 文件系统选择“ext4”

     - 再次点击“+”标志,挂载点选择“/boot”,分配1GB

     - 文件系统选择“ext4”

     - 再次点击“+”标志,挂载点选择“swap”,分配2GB

    swap是交换分区,用于在内存不足时提供虚拟内存

     - 分区完成后,点击“完成”

     5.禁用KDUMP: - 点击“KDUMP”,取消勾选“启用KDUMP(E)”,然后点击“完成”

     6.配置网络和主机名: - 点击“网络和主机名”,打开以太网开关,然后点击“完成”

     7.开始安装: - 上述配置完成后,点击“开始安装(B)”

     - 安装过程中,你需要设置root密码和创建一个普通用户

    root用户具有最高权限,普通用户则权限较少

     8.安装完成: - 安装完成后,点击“重启”

     - 重启完成后,接受许可协议,并完成系统配置

     六、后续配置 1.安装VMware Tools: - 在虚拟机菜单中,选择“安装VMware Tools”

    这将增强虚拟机的性能和功能,如共享文件夹、拖放文件等

     2.更新系统: - 登录系统后,使用`yum update`命令更新系统软件包

     3.安装其他软件: - 根据需要,你可以使用`yum install`命令安装其他软件

     七、常见问题排查 1.虚拟机无法启动: - 检查ISO镜像文件是否正确挂载

     - 确保虚拟机配置正确,特别是内存和处理器设置

     2.安装过程中报错: - 检查ISO镜像文件是否完整

     - 尝试重新下载ISO镜像文件,并重新配置虚拟机

     3.网络无法连接: - 检查虚拟机网络设置,确保选择了正确的网络连接方式(如NAT)

     - 重启虚拟机网络服务

     通过以上步骤,你应该能够成功在虚拟机中安装Linux系统

    如果在安装过程中遇到问题,可以查阅虚拟机软件和Linux发行版的官方文档,或者寻求社区和论坛的帮助

    祝你安装顺利,享受Linux系统的强大功能!